Microsoft Excel 2002 Intermediate

This Microsoft Excel course is designed for all users who are required to produce complex analysis of business data using Microsoft Excel 2002. Building on the basics, the Microsoft Office Excel training course focuses on functions, conditional formatting and using multiple worksheets.

You will need to have completed the Excel fundamentals course or have equivalent knowledge. It is not suitable as an introduction for people who have little or no experience with this software.

This Microsoft Excel course aims to cover:

  • Using multiple worksheets
  • Import external data 
  • Using the hide and protect options
  • Text manipulation functions
  • Using the group and outline tools
  • Using ‘Lookup’ functions
  • Using the ‘IF’ function
  • Building advance graphs
  • Conditional formatting.

This Microsoft Excel course will help you learn how to:

  • Navigate large worksheets effectively by using magnification, frozen panes, and split panes; and control the printing of large worksheets
  • Navigate, manage, and print multiple worksheets; link workbooks by using 3-D formulas; and summarise data by using the Consolidate command
  • Change the View, General, and Calculation settings of Excel; and customise toolbars and menus
  • Add borders and shading; apply special formats; create, apply, and modify styles; and change the orientation of cells
  • Sort lists by columns; and filter lists based on complex criteria
  • Format data points; create combination charts and trend lines; and add and format graphic elements
  • Embed and link objects in a worksheet; and allow several users to work with the same data by sharing, merging, and tracking changes
  • Use auditing features; add comments and text boxes; and protect a worksheet or part of a worksheet
  • Use the VLOOKUP function to find a value in a worksheet list; use the MATCH function to find the relative position of a value in a range; use the INDEX function to find the value of a cell at a given position within a range
  • Use IF functions to determine an outcome based on criteria.
